Ticket: Drift on Wikiloft RBAC config (staging vs prod)

So staging somehow ended up with the `editors` role able to delete spaces, which prod (correctly) doesn't allow. Best guess: someone hot-patched staging during the Bramblewick onboarding and never backported it. I've reverted staging to match the repo and added a drift check to the nightly job. Please sanity-check that the permitted actions match what we agreed in the access review. Current intended values are below.

settings of fafog-haduf:
ZORIX_PIN=4648
ZORIX_METRICS_HOST=metrics.zorix.paliqsys.corp
ZORIX_LOG_LEVEL=info
ZORIX_TENANT=druix

Payroll exports for Ledgerfen moved from fixed-width to CSV in release 41. Old parser is gone; don't resurrect it. Regenerate any export dated before the cutover. Column order is frozen — never reorder. Exports upload nightly to the Brindle drop. The credential for that upload is defined on the next line.

vault entry, kahip-fahog: RELAY_SECRET20=6a2c791de808f35c3b55

## Capacity note: Spoolwright service

Quick one for on-call. Spoolwright handles print jobs for all of the
Harlow Park offices, and Mondays at 09:00 are brutal — roughly 4x the
weekday average. The worker pool autoscales, but the spool disk does
not, so the real constraint is the per-job size cap and the queue-depth
watermark. If the queue alarm fires, check for a single giant PDF before
scaling anything. We sized the defaults off last quarter's peak plus
30% headroom. The knobs live here:

tuning table, yajog-yahof:
BUDGETS = {
    "lamvan": 303,
    "wenox": 460,
    "fenvan": 525,
}

## Ticket: Signature check fails on offline bundle — TerraNote 2.8

Field units running TerraNote's offline survey mode reject the 2.8 map bundle with a signature mismatch. Root cause: the packaging job signed the bundle before the offline tile index was appended, so the digest no longer matches. Fix is to reorder the pipeline steps and re-sign. For future maintainers verifying reissued bundles, validation should be performed against the current signing key.

signing key of bagap-yawep = bky13_TbfT6ZMUoGJo2